How To Play DVDs On Your Wii

The Nintendo Wii is truly an amazing machine. For such a small piece of equipment it has a lot of power. However, in comparison to the Xbox 360 and PlayStation 3, the Nintendo Wii is missing some important features that keep it from being the number one multimedia console.

The Nintendo Wii was never intended to be a DVD player, but there’s an easy way to turn the Wii into a DVD player and get rid of the DVD player in your home entertainment system.

Here is what you need to do to enable DVD playback on your Wii. We will not be installing a mod chip into your Wii, this solution does require a free software file that possibly voids the Wii’s warranty. Just be aware that this could break your Nintendo Wii; you’ve been warned. Follow these steps and you should be ok.

To start with, install the Wii Homebrew Channel onto your Wii using the Twilight Princess hack. Do a online search on Bing and those steps are not hard to find.

After the Homebrew Channel is installed, whichever method you choose to use, install MPlayer. MPlayer is a small media player that will let you run the DVD disc like a regular DVD player. You can find it in the same place as the Homebrew Channel. Again, not hard to find.

Retrieve and install the DvdX loader program. This file somewhat changes your Wii’s system and thus starts the playback of the DVD.

Now that everything is installed, take stock of where you are. Everything still good to go? Good. Start up the Homebrew channel and begin MPlayer. You’ll see a menu that will let you choose the DVD and then begin the DVD just like you would on a common DVD player.

Once Wii Homebrew is installed there are a number of other things you can do, like play old NES, SNES, and N64 games, even listen to your CDs. Have fun with you Nintendo Wii console.

 

Investing in Shares Online

When you have finally decided to go online and purchase shares, you will want to keep the following information in mind. There is a myth about online share trading that; the more money you put in the greater your return will be. This is not necessarily true. You decide how much you want to put in. However if you do put in large amounts of money and manage a diverse portfolio you might see returns more quickly.

Remember; never use your bread and butter money. When you invest money, you will want to make sure that it is money that you are willing to lose. If it is money that you really need you will not want to invest it, as you might lose some of it or you won’t be able to retrieve that money as quick as you would want to. Always make informed decisions about the shares you want to purchase by identifying which are good and which are bad investments. As you keep learning how to trade shares, you will start to obtain more knowledge.

Diversify, diversify and diversify. Don’t put all your eggs in one basket. When the basket falls, you lose all your eggs. If you invest a large amount, try to by shares in as many, well established, companies as you can. E.g. you want to invest R50,000.00. Split the investment amount 5 ways, thus investing R10,000.00 in 5 different companies. By doing this you are spreading your risk.

Trade shares in companies that are financially strong and have a good past and future. There are a lot of different companies listed at the JSE; the well established ones are usually on the Main Board. Visit the JSE website to find out more about the companies listed on the Main Board. An alternative is to visit the AltX, here you will find the smaller companies. These companies’s shares are usually very cheap and you can by a lot for just a little money.

Remember there are no short cuts to becoming a well established share trader. Sometimes you will lose some money. What makes you a good trader is how well you can pick yourself up and carry on.
